- It would be really nice if configure and Makefile.in didn't force a
trailing /nmh on the pathnames I supply for libexecdir and sysconfdir.

This is trivial because it was easy enough to edit both files myself
to make the change I wanted, but it would be much nicer if there were
a way to do that by supplying an option to configure.

It looks like we had that discussion here:
  http://lists.nongnu.org/archive/html/nmh-workers/2014-10/msg00000.html
And I said at the time I wasn't so crazy with appending /nmh to those
directories, but I didn't realize that the implementation meant that
specifying --sysconfdir wouldn't work.  So I think that this should be
overridable via configure.

Possibly related to this: I updated nmh from 1.6 to 1.7 on my RHEL6
machine last night, using the EPEL package (last touched by David Levine).
I noticed that it moved all the configuration files from /etc/nmh/ to
/etc/nmh/nmh/, which seems a tad silly.
